Racine – Robert Richard Connell, 53, passed away unexpectedly at his residence on September 7, 2019. He was born in Milwaukee on December 22, 1965, son of the late William and Patricia (Nee: Pesko) Connell.
Bob was a coil winder for the Eaton Corporation. He liked to live life to the fullest and was always on the go. Bob had a sincere appreciation for nice vehicles and things that “go fast” including motorcycles, jet skis, and snowmobiles. His creativity and ingenuity are showcased in much of his work, including his home which was the ultimate expression for who he was. His ability to see the best in everything that he did, will leave a lasting impression on anyone who knew him. Bob had many family and friends that loved him and he will be truly missed.
Bob leaves to cherish his memory, his son, Gage (fiancé: Beth Maurer) Connell; brother, Mike (Romy) Connell; sister, Karen Deleon; nieces and nephews, Edward Connell, Michelle Connell, Stephen Connell, Samuel Connell, Lando Deleon, Sophia Deleon; former wife, Shellah Connell; his faithful canine companion, Digger; other relatives and dear friends too numerous to mention.
Bob is preceded in death by his parents, William and Patricia Connell.
A celebration of Bob’s life will be held on Saturday, September 21, 2019, 12:00pm, at Draeger-Langendorf Funeral Home and Crematory, 4600 County Line Road. Visitation will be from 10:00am until the time of the service.
